opened in april instead of june this year. ran the numbers on what those two extra months actually cost me
opened april 12 this year instead of waiting for june. first time I've ever done that.
east tennessee, 21ft round, about 10k gallons, sand filter, small heat pump I put in last spring. power here is about 11 cents.
figured the bill would punish me for it. it didn't, and the reason wasn't what I was watching.
the heat pump was about what you'd expect. april and may it ran maybe six hours a day and added something like $70 a month. from june on it barely kicks on.
the part I didn't see coming was the pump. I borrowed a clamp meter and measured every speed instead of guessing:
3450 rpm, about 1250w
2400, about 430
1800, about 190
1500, about 115
half the speed is nowhere near half the power. flow only falls off in a straight line, so per gallon moved, slow wins by a lot.
I used to run 8 hours at full tilt out of habit, about $33 a month. it sits at 1500 for 16 hours now, closer to $6.
that $27 a month back covers most of the heating.
so the two extra months of swimming have run me under $90 so far. a little over a dollar a day.
one warning. I tried 1200 and the skimmer quit pulling, bugs just sat there. 1400 is my floor. btw mine's an aquastrong 1.5hp variable speed, so your speed steps probably won't line up with mine.
